|  | Administrator Forum Administrator | | Join Date: Oct 2002 Location: Lower Westchester, NY | | It was Guy Pratt, UK session bass dude. He also played on "Like A Prayer" by Madonna, which has some really nice playing on it.
If I remember correctly, he used a Status through an octaver on both recordings.
Legend has it that Guy never even got paid for the MJ session!  |
